Signs Help Visitors and Volunteers Navigate Weiser’s Hillcrest Cemetery

  • Local Champion: Hillcrest Cemetery District
  • Date Funded: March 22, 2024
  • Grant Amount: $6,069

A few times each month volunteers at Weiser’s Hillcrest Cemetery find themselves at a loss. Without clear signs throughout the cemetery, they struggle to give directions to the visitors trying to find the burial plots of their loved ones. The visitors often grow frustrated, upending the sacred and deeply personal experience. One passionate cemetery volunteer recognized the challenge she had pointing out plot locations. She had the idea to place markers throughout the cemetery, but the cemetery’s limited budget was a barrier. In need of help, she reached out to LOR. LOR’s funding will help the cemetery, a division of Washington County, purchase 19 weather-resistant signs from a local supplier and other supplies to install them. In addition, LOR’s funding will help the cemetery acquire 200 aluminum plates to serve as markers for the cemetery’s unmarked graves, giving families and their loved ones the respect they deserve.
